What teeth straightening is

Teeth straightening refers to treatment that has the goal of improving the alignment of teeth. There is a range of possible treatment options for patients to consider, including traditional metal braces, clear aligners and more. Each option has its own pros and cons, and general dentists and patients together can make an informed decision as to which option is the most appropriate. Teeth straightening can fix a range of cosmetic and oral health concerns, including crooked teeth, overcrowding and more. 

Who offers teeth straightening

While some types of dental health professionals offer more specific treatments, dentists of all varieties can choose to focus on and offer teeth straightening for their patients. Many general dentists offer teeth straightening to their patients. In large part, this is because clear aligners, braces and other methods work to improve oral health as well as cosmetic appearance. In some instances in which teeth are crowded or crooked, it can be hard to reach all areas of teeth while brushing, increasing the risk of a cavity and other oral health concerns. 

When to consider teeth straightening

Anyone who is not happy with the appearance of their smile or who deals with oral health issues because of misalignment should consider the benefits of treatment. Teeth straightening methods aim to fix a range of alignment concerns. They can address issues with both jaw alignment and misalignment of the teeth:

  • Crooked teeth
  • Overcrowding
  • Gap teeth
  • Bite complications

There are treatment methods available to both patients with a mild to moderate issue and those who have a more severe malocclusion. 

How the treatment process works

The first step in teeth straightening from a general dentist is to arrange a consultation visit. During the visit, the dentist will conduct an oral examination and likely order dental X-rays. Once both the patient and the dentist agree on the best form of treatment, they can move forward with wearing the aligner or braces chosen. Treatment typically takes anywhere from six months to two years, after which the patient may need to wear a retainer as directed.
